Transaction 87423b143d21f716e02c7c18dfd72f64ab35e91593eb3a7afe23e28c6aee938a

1 Input
2 Outputs
  • 87423b143d21f716e02c7c18dfd72f64ab35e91593eb3a7afe23e28c6aee938a:0
  • value  142358939
    address  1KhC12mg4dox947EWTLNZ9SgvhoD9kziw7
  • 87423b143d21f716e02c7c18dfd72f64ab35e91593eb3a7afe23e28c6aee938a:1
  • value  2310061
    address  1JCVQZcCLr2PfLLeDkYGtUVMYBrBXDftdu